Choosing the Right Coop

There are many chicken coop plans that the person can choose from, as well as chicken coop designs to choose from. For example, there are those that are wooden and those that are plastic. Popularity wise, most people are going to find that the wooden chick coops designs are going to be found in nature much more. The reason for this is the fact that the wood coops have a reputation as holding up much better against the forces of nature. These wooden coops are going to have shingles on their roof and be put together through the use of screws and nails, and are more times than not a permanent fixture in the area that they are placed. The second type of chicken coops that are out there is the plastic coops that are usually referred to as Eglus. The reason for the name is the fact that they do resemble an igloo. The person is going to find that this may not be as sturdy as other chicken coops designs that are out there since they are made of plastic and are a bit more flimsy.

Wooden Coops

Within the wooden realm of chicken coops, there are many chicken coop designs that the person can choose from, all of which are deigned for a specific situation in mind. For example, the Ark design is one that is going to be used in places in which the chickens cannot roam that far in the yard that they are placed since they may be in fear of predators or simply not have the room. These chicken coops do allow for the sun to be in, while providing shelter for the chickens at all times. The most common type of wooden chicken coop is the classic coop that has wood, mesh wire and enough room to house chickens during times in which they are not outside. However, for those that are wanting to find an affordable and easy chicken coop plan is going to find that the poultry shed is the best bet. It is simple in construction and allows chicken access in, while keeping predators out, which is the main reason to have a chicken coop in the first place.

Features and Specs

When looking at these chicken coop plans there are many things that the person needs to make sure that they have in the coop in order for it to work for them in the long run. For example, the person must make sure that the chicken coop is going to allow the chickens ease of access in, while keeping predators out. The person must also make sure that they have access into the chicken coop in order to clean it out. Access to food and water in the chicken coop is a must as well since there may be days in which the chickens are not going to be able to get out into the yard that they are fenced into. Having access to light while in the chicken coop is also something to take into consideration. And this can be through the use of sky lights and other aspects in the roof to allow for the sunlight to get into the home. Finally, the person wants to make sure that the chicken coops allow for the chickens to feel safe and secure in the coop in order to lay their eggs. With that being said, having a way to get the eggs out of the chicken coop is also something that the person wants to look into.

Look for Signs of Predators

The first thing that the person should know about raising chickens is that they are going to want to start in the morning with their routine. The routine should consist of checking the coop to ensure that predators have not made any obvious damage to the chicken coop, which does happen as these animals are after the chicken. Thus, you want to make sure that the coop is holding strong so that your time of raising chickens is not cut short by predators.

Feeding and Watering

Feed and water the chickens each and every day. The person can alleviate the task every day by using automatic feeder and water systems which they will then only have to check to make sure that they are full and are working properly. This is something that can make the raising of chickens a bit easier for those that are delivering the care each and every day. You should also take the time each day to look over the chickens. Do you notice that they are not eating or drinking properly? This could be an issue and be something that points to there being an illness in the flock. You should also make sure that you are counting these each day and nothing is happening to these chickens without your knowledge.

Cleaning the Coop

Cleaning the coop is also something that the person is going to have to do each day. You are going to want to clean out where the chickens are sleeping, as the hay and other items that are used to make this more comfortable can house bugs and other critters that you do not want to run across. Of course, the chickens are also going to use the coop as a bathroom, thus you should disinfect this each day to make sure that you are keeping the chances of rapid disease and illness from taking over your coop.
